## v2.14.3 — Hotfix

Finally tracked down the memory leak in Pixelhoard's thumbnail cache — evicted entries were keeping decoded bitmaps alive via a stale listener. Patched in this release; heap should flatten out within an hour of deploy. If it doesn't, roll back and page whoever's listed below. Fix was owned and verified by the engineer named here.

signatory, tadug-fajop: Fraath Norius Norwyn

Hi branch managers — heads up that we're moving from Cartwell Freight to Lunemark Logistics starting next quarter. The short version: better regional coverage, faster turnaround on the Oakhollow–Bryce corridor, and fewer lost-pallet headaches. Expect a two-week overlap period where both carriers handle shipments, so label everything carefully. Training materials for the new booking portal land in your inboxes soon. Flag any contract oddities with your local depots before the cutover date. The confidential business note follows below.

confidential, fahag-yahap: Project Raleth slips by six weeks because of the tooling delay.

**Ticket PKT-88: Webhook fires twice on parcel handoff**

For whoever inherits this: the Cartwheel parcel-tracking webhook double-fires when a package moves from the Delven hub to a courier within the same minute. Downstream, Merrow's notifier then texts customers twice. Root cause looks like a missing idempotency check in the handoff event coalescer. Repro steps attached. The offending deploy is identified by the token below.

trace token, hawep-hadug: htk3_9c2